M.A.I.N.
(Militarism, Alliances, Imperialism, Expansionism, and Nationalism) - causes of WWI. Each of these factors contributed to the causes and devastation of this war.
Trench Warfare
type of warfare used where opposing armies faced each other in entrenched positions.

Zimmerman Telegram
Encrypted letter written by Arthur Zimmerman, prompting Mexico to start a war with the United States to acquire land taken during the Mexican-American War
Unrestricted Submarine Warfare
A type of German naval warfare in which all ships were a target without warning
Propaganda
A way to shape opinion during WWI to make people think the way a government wanted
Armistice
a temporary cessation of fighting by mutual consent during war.
Fourteen Points
Post WWI Peace plan written by U.S. Pres. Woodrow Wilson. Emphasized freedom of seas, trade, and self determination; leniency towards Germany. U.S. Senate rejected
Treaty of Versailles
Peace treaty signed by Germany and the Allies at the end of WWI, rejected by U.S. Senate
League of Nations
A world organization established in 1920 to promote international cooperation and peace, rejected by U.S. Senate
